Packt Publishing Donates Over $100,000 to Open Source Projects

    Packt today announced that its donations to Open Source projects surpassed the $100,000 mark. Following its first donation to the phpMyAdmin project in April 2004, the company has gone on to provide sustained support for over thirty different open source projects.

Packt has introduced initiatives such as the Open Source Project Royalty Scheme and Open Source CMS Award to provide sustained donations to projects over the last four years. The Open Source Project Royalty Scheme allows projects to benefit from the publication of a book, as they are allocated a percentage of every copy sold. “This is something that we offer to every open source project that we publish on” said Damian Carvill, Packt’s marketing manager. “Packt is proud to have reached this significant milestone and remains committed to keeping donations at the heart of its long-term publishing strategy.”
